Removal Procedure

W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 2004 Pontiac Aztek and 2004 Buick Rendezvous.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.
  1. Disconnect the negative battery cable. Refer to Battery Negative Cable Disconnect/Connect Procedure (LA1) or Battery Negative Cable Disconnect/Connect Procedure (LY7) in Engine Electrical.
  2. Remove the front door trim panel. Refer to Trim Panel Replacement - Side Front Door (Aztek)  or Trim Panel Replacement - Side Front Door (Rendezvous) .
  3. Remove the front door water deflector. Refer to Water Deflector Replacement - Front Door 
  4. Remove the front door rubber conduit from the front door. Refer to Rubber Conduit Replacement - Front Door .
  5. Disconnect the front door wiring harness connectors from all the accessories.

  6. Disconnect the front door wiring harness rosebud retainers from the inner front door panel.
  7. Remove the front door wiring harness from the front door.
